The Role of the Internet of Things in Expanding Micro Data Centers

The Internet of Things (IoT) is pushing data centers to their limits. Facility managers are grappling with increased capacity demands and latency concerns, underscoring the need for a nimble, innovative solution. Micro Data Centers (MDCs) at the network edge are emerging as the ideal solution, offering a compact yet highly efficient data processing environment.

Exploring Micro Data Centers

A Micro Data Center is a modular, pre-configured system that integrates power, cooling, monitoring, and racks seamlessly into existing infrastructures. Often unnoticed, MDCs are integral to various industries, playing pivotal roles in reducing latency and increasing efficiency.

Benefits of Micro Data Centers

Traditional data rooms are often costly and inefficient, necessitating months of planning for expansion. MDCs offer a cost-effective alternative, reducing latency and operational costs while enhancing data transfer speeds by situating storage closer to end-users. By leveraging IoT data from diverse sources, MDCs offer the flexibility and speed required in today’s data-driven world.

Key Features of Micro Data Centers

Micro Data Centers are adaptable, self-contained units that can expand capacity or serve as remote storage facilities. They feature:

  • Power and climate control systems
  • Network connectivity and monitoring
  • Physical and fire protection
  • Shock absorption and EMI shielding
  • Uninterruptible power supplies and batteries
  • Scalable racking solutions

These units are easily deployable, ranging in size from compact models that fit under desks to large units comparable to trailers, all designed to scale with your business needs.

Frequently Asked Questions about Micro Data Centers

What is a Micro Data Center?
A Micro Data Center is a compact, modular unit designed to provide power, cooling, and data processing capabilities at the network’s edge.

Why are Micro Data Centers growing in popularity?
As IoT devices proliferate, MDCs offer a scalable solution for processing data closer to the end-user, reducing latency and operational costs.

How do Micro Data Centers integrate with existing systems?
MDCs are designed to seamlessly integrate with existing data infrastructures, enhancing capacity without requiring major overhauls.

What industries benefit the most from Micro Data Centers?
Telecommunications, retail, and education are among the sectors leveraging MDCs for improved performance and connectivity.
